DP-3000 | ErrPayload | Error en el payload enviado en la petición o esta vacío | Verificar el payload que se esta enviando, validar si los campos enviados son los requeridos o si esta vacío. |
DP-3001 | ErrCannotParseData | No se puede verificar la data enviada | Validar el payload de data que se envía en la solicitud es correcto |
DP-3002 | ErrRequestServiceError | Error en la petición que se realizo | Volver a realizar una petición con los datos correctos |
DP-3003 | ErrAmountRequest | Error en el monto enviado | Validar que el campo de los montos coincidan o no vayan nulos en la petición |
DP-4000 | ErrMissingHeaders | No se encontró el encabezado de la petición | Verificar que el encabezado se esté enviando de manera correcta en la petición. |
DP-4001 | ErrUnauthorized | Sin autorización | Falta el X-API-Key en el encabezado de la petición. |
DP-4002 | ErrCardTokenForbidden | Tarjeta prohibida | La tarjeta se encuentra en la lista negra de fraudes. |
DP-4003 | ErrStoreCodeValidation | No se encontró el código de la tienda | Revisar el código de la tienda que se esta enviando dentro de la petición. |
DP-4004 | ErrValidation | Revisar el payload enviado | Validar que el payload enviado se encuentre con la estructura requerida. |
DP-4005 | ErrMerchantIDValidation | No se encontró el código del comercio | Verificar si el código de la tienda es el correcto o si se esta enviando vacío. |
DP-4006 | ErrUserValidation | Usuario es requerido | Se debe enviar la información del usuario al crear la orden. |
DP-4007 | ErrParseUuid | No se puede obtener el token de orden | Revisar si el token de la orden se esta enviando correctamente. |
DP-4008 | ErrCardNotFound | Tarjeta no encontrada | El numero de la tarjeta no es correcto, intentar con una nueva tarjeta. |
DP-4009 | ErrProcessorNotFound | No se ha encontrado el procesador para la tarjeta de crédito | Revisar en el Admin si el método de pago esta configurado. |
Dp-4100 | ErrMissingCVV | No se encontró el cvv | Revisar que se este enviando el cvv dentro de la petición. |
DP-4101 | ErrInvalidCVV | El cvv es inválido | El cvv de la tarjeta no es correcto, intentar con un cvv válido. |
DP-4200 | ErrTransactionProcessor | Error con la comunicación del procesador | Volver a intentar la transacción o intentar con otro procesador de pago |
DP-4300 | ErrExpCard | Error en la fecha de expiración | Solicitar que se ingrese la información correcta de la tarjeta |
DP-4301 | ErrIDUser | Error en el número/tipo de identificación | Solicitar que se ingrese la información correcta de la cédula de identificación |
DP-4302 | ErrNameUser | Error en el nombre del tarjetahabiente | Solicitar que se ingrese la información correcta de la tarjeta |
DP-4303 | ErrNumberCard | Error en el numero de la tarjeta | Solicitar que se ingrese la información correcta de la tarjeta |
DP-4400 | ErrProcessing3DS | Error en el procesamiento con 3DS | Intentar de nuevo con otra tarjeta o medio de pago |
DP-4500 | ErrBankRejected | Declinación general por el banco emisor | Intentar de nuevo con otra tarjeta o medio de pago |
DP-5001 | ErrNotImplemented | Método de pago no configurado | Revisar en el Admin si el método de pago esta configurado. |
DP-5002 | ErrDB | Transacción no encontrada | La transacción no pudo ser encontrada en la BD, revisar la información para confirmar que se este enviando correctamente. |
DP-6000 | ErrRequestAlreadyProcessed | Solicitud ya procesada o en curso | La solicitud ya se encuentra procesada o esta en curso, enviar otra solicitud. |
DP-6001 | ErrCannotUpdateTransaction | No se puede actualizar la transacción | Volver a enviar otra solicitud para actualizar la transacción. |
DP-6002 | ErrCannotFindTransaction | No se encuentra la transacción | Revisar si la transacción se esta enviando de manera correcta. |
DP-6003 | ErrUnknownPayment | La transacción podría no haber sido aprobada | Realizar otra transacción o probar con otro procesador de pago |
DP-6004 | ErrCannotFindOrCreateTransaction | No se puede encontrar o crear una transacción | Hacer otra transacción o intentar con otro procesador de pago |
DP-7011 | ErrWaitingOTP | Esperando código OTP | Esperar al envio del código OTP requerido para completar la transacción |
DP-7012 | ErrFailureOTP | Fallo OTP | El código OTP ingresado no es correcto, revisar o solicitar un nuevo código |
DP-7022 | ErrCardVault | No se puede obtener la tarjeta | El número de la tarjeta es incorrecto o se encuentra en la lista de fraudes, intentar con otra tarjeta. |
DP-7023 | ErrSistecreditoPayment | Error en la creación del pago | Revisar la información enviada para realizar el pago |
DP-7050 | ErrTransbankPurchase | Error en la creación del pago | Revisar información enviada al momento de procesar el pago, device session, formato de order ID, installments |
DP-7051 | ErrTransbankAuthorize | Error en la autorización del pago | Revisar información enviada al momento de procesar el pago, device session, formato de order ID, installments |
DP-7052 | ErrTransbankCapture | Error capturando el pago | Revisar información enviada al momento de capturar el pago, no soporta capturas parciales con installments, monto debe ser menor o igual al autorizado |
DP-7053 | ErrTransbankRefund | Error devolvendo el pago | Revisar información enviada al momento de devolver el pago, no soporta devoluciones parciales con installments, monto debe ser menor o igual al capturado |
DP-7054 | ErrTransbankVoid | Error cancelando la autorización de pago | Revisar información enviada al momento de cancelar el pago, funciona de forma similar a una devolución |
DP-7100 | ErrDeferPayment | Error en la petición de diferir cobro | Revisar la configuración del método de pago |
DP-8000 | ErrCannotGenerateQR | No se puede generar el código QR | Validar si el contenido que ira dentro del QR es correcto. |
DP-8001 | ErrFraudValidation | La transacción podría no haber sido aprobada | Realizar otra transacción debido a que fue rechazada por nuestro sistema anti fraude |
DP-8002 | ErrFraudSystemConn | Método de pago no encontrado o error de conexión | Revisar el método de pago que se solicito se encuentra dentro del Admin |
DP-9000 | ErrInsufficientFunds | No se cuenta con los fondos en la cuenta para poder finalizar la orden | Intentar de nuevo con otra tarjeta o medio de pago |
DP-9001 | ErrMaxAttemps | Se ha alcanzado el limite de intentos/saldo | Intentar de nuevo con otra tarjeta o medio de pago |
DP-9999 | ErrUnknown | Unknown error | Error desconocido, vuelva a realizar una nueva solicitud |